How do I get from Mantes-la-Jolie port to Paris?
Mantes-la-Jolie is located approximately 50 kilometers west of Paris. You can reach Paris by taking a regional train (SNCF) from Mantes-la-Jolie station, which takes about 45 minutes to an hour, or by arranging a taxi or shuttle service through your cruise line. Many cruises from this port include Paris as a destination or offer organized shore excursions.
What can I see in a day at Mantes-la-Jolie?
Mantes-la-Jolie features the stunning Collegiate Church of Notre-Dame, a masterpiece of Gothic architecture, and charming riverside walks along the Seine. The town offers local shops, cafés, and museums showcasing regional history. Most visitors also use the port as a gateway to explore nearby attractions like Versailles or venture into the picturesque Normandy countryside.
